Banff has four distinct seasons. When traveling here, it’s important to note that the weather in the Canadian Rockies is variable due to the high elevation and rugged topography; mountain weather is unpredictable and can change rapidly.
It’s possible to get rain, snow, wind and sunshine on the same day. Since mountain ranges create their own local climates, conditions can vary from one location to the next.
The summer climate is pleasant with low humidity, warm temperatures and daylight hours stretching until 11 pm. Days are usually warm, but it can get cool at night. The months of April, and October to early November see weather ranging from summer to winter conditions.
Warming Chinook winds can bring spring-like conditions in winter. Winter temperatures dip below freezing, with frequent snowfalls. Located in the Chinook belt, the winter in Banff is milder in the rest of Northern Alberta. Temperatures can be as high as 30C/86F in the summer to as low as –30C/22F in the winter.
